Job description
About the Role
Corpay is seeking a Human Resources Manager based in Nagpur, India to lead and enhance operational excellence within the HR function. This role focuses on driving strategic HR initiatives, delivering insightful workforce analytics, and optimizing HR processes and systems to improve both employee and management experiences through increased efficiency and continuous improvement.
Work Environment
The role requires collaboration across various teams including HR Business Partners, business leaders, and Centers of Excellence. Depending on demands, the position may entail onsite or hybrid work arrangements.
Key Responsibilities
- Lead company-wide HR operations projects emphasizing automation, process streamlining, workforce data governance, and regulatory compliance.
- Deliver strategic workforce insights via advanced analytics and translate data into actionable recommendations for HR and business leaders.
- Manage HR reporting tools including dashboards, workforce metrics, and planning inputs that assist business decisions.
- Continuously enhance HR systems, workflows, and SOPs to boost efficiency, scalability, and accuracy of data.
- Collaborate on major organizational projects such as restructures, policy rollouts, organizational design, and workforce planning.
- Maintain governance frameworks ensuring data integrity, accurate reporting, and legal compliance.
- Identify and implement technology and automation opportunities to elevate HR service delivery.
- Partner with HRIS, Payroll, Talent Acquisition, Compensation, and IT teams to support enterprise-level HR initiatives.
- Prepare polished reports and presentations for executives highlighting workforce trends and operational performance.
- Mentor HR analysts fostering a culture of accountability, excellence, and ongoing improvement.
Qualifications & Skills
- Bachelor's degree in Human Resources, Business Administration, Analytics or related discipline; Master's preferred.
- Minimum 7 years of escalating experience in HR Operations, HR Analytics, HRIS, or general Human Resources.
- Proven expertise leading HR operations or analytics functions within complex global organizations.
- Strong analytical capabilities to convert workforce data into impactful business insights.
- Experience building executive dashboards, KPI reports, and workforce planning models.
- Comprehensive knowledge of HR compliance, governance, and data management.
- Successful track record of driving operational improvements, automation, and digital transformation.
- Robust project management skills managing multiple priorities effectively.
- Excellent verbal and written communication, including presentations to senior leadership.
- Ability to build influence and relationships at all organizational levels.
- Advanced proficiency with Microsoft Excel, Power BI, Tableau or comparable analytics and reporting tools.
- Preferred experience with major HRIS platforms like Workday, SAP SuccessFactors, Oracle HCM, or UKG.
